“Gunjou Biyori” by Tokyo Jihen is also a rock song that leaves you feeling energized after listening.

What’s amazing about them is how cool their music is—especially the lyrics.

Despite being rock, there’s hardly any English in the lyrics.

You could say it’s truly Japanese-made rock.

RIP SLYME’s songs are upbeat and lift the listener’s spirits.

They have many tracks that feel like the height of summer, and one of their signature songs, “Rakuen Baby,” is exactly that kind of track.

Listening to it will surely cheer you up and make you look forward to summer.

“Letter: Dear 15-Year-Old Me” is a famous song by Angela Aki.

Especially in junior high and high school, it often appears in music textbooks and is sung as a choral piece, so many people have chances to encounter it.

It’s a ballad that will surely lift your spirits when you listen to it.

Naotaro Moriyama, who is now active as a top musician both in name and in reality, made his debut in the 2000s.

“Sakura (Dokusho)” is one of the songs that showcased his exceptional vocal ability to the world.

It’s a classic you’ll definitely want to listen to during the spring cherry blossom season.

Crazy Ken Band is a rock band with a unique charm that incorporates elements of nostalgic Showa-era pop.

Their appeal lies, above all, in their grown-up ambiance.

One of their signature songs, “Tiger & Dragon,” also gained popularity as the theme song for a hit TV drama.

GReeeeN is a hip-hop group that made a major breakthrough in the 2000s, gaining attention for their captivating songs and the members’ unique academic backgrounds.

Their tracks are all uplifting and especially popular among younger generations.
